Abstract :
Through the experiments for syntheses of ABO4 (A: Al, Fe, Cr, In, La, Bi; B: P, V, Nb, Sb), investigations on the relation between mechanochemical reactivity and (I): the crystal structure of starting materials or (II): the crystal structure of product materials has been conducted. It has been found that it is a necessary condition to use structurally active substances against milling operation for the occurrence of a mechanochemical reaction. In addition, it is easier to facilitate a mechanochemical reaction to form ABO4-type oxide which is of larger size of cation and in denser structural state.
